MetroFax Review and Overview
Fax still serves as a highly reliable way of transferring important, tangible documents within or outside of an organization. While this was a way harder task before the online revolution, where both parties required a dedicated fax machine for transferal, nowadays with services like MetroFax, organizations can easily transfer fax data with one device only, and that too without the hassles of setting up separate telephone networks. MetroFax works over the internet and is ideal for operations involving contracts and such where only physical documents are considered valid. It is fast and much more convenient than its predecessors, and is a much cheaper alternative as well. Even its setup process is simple enough to require no additional help from hardware or software technicians.
How can MetroFax optimize the process of faxing?
MetroFax uses an internet connection for transmitting document files. These files are of PDF format and are easier to handle and print. Since it uses an internet connection, it is much faster and more secure than simpler telephonic networks. Users also have complete freedom of sending on whatever medium they desire, be it a desktop, laptop or even a mobile device. MetroFax provides several time-saving features which makes it all the more feasible.

How is MetroFax’s novel technology used?
MetroFax basically uses a proprietary email-like system for transferring documents. The user just needs to enter the fax number of the intended recipient along with the MetroFax email in the "To" box of the email, attach the file to be faxed, and send it. The fax will receive and print the document almost instantly. If there is a failure in transfer, the program will retry again and again until either it is sent or the user has canceled the transfer.
